This beautiful apartment, with its warm and welcoming atmosphere, enjoys an exceptional location on the shores of Lake Gaillands. Ideal for a couple with children, it offers two comfortable bedrooms, one of which has its own en-suite bathroom.
You will find all the amenities you need for a pleasant stay, including a washing machine and plenty of storage space.
The bright living room, equipped with a fireplace for cosy evenings, opens onto a large covered terrace. This offers a real space to relax with breathtaking views of the Mont Blanc massif and the lake, the perfect setting to enjoy a coffee at sunrise or an aperitif at the end of the day.
The Gaillands neighbourhood is very well served by public transport, with quick access to buses and trains. The town centre is also just a few minutes' walk away, allowing you to easily enjoy the shops, restaurants and entertainment of Chamonix while living in a quiet and natural environment.

As the global capital of winter sports, Chamonix’s history, skiing and scenery make it a true alpine legend. Every seasoned snow lover should come here at least once; skiing the awesome terrain from a proper mountain town with the Mont Blanc massif as your backdrop will make for a week to remember.
